Plot Summary: Two college kids, heading home for Christmas break, become stranded along a haunted road. (WPRI) – New Hampshire's Mount Washington, the highest peak in the Northeast, recorded the coldest wind chill in the history of the United States on Saturday morning when an arctic air mass hit New England.
